What Are The 3 Main Qualities High Achievers Work On?
Have you ever noticed that the most powerful people rarely rush?
They don’t race through their ideas. They don’t fill every silence. They don’t react impulsively.
They act and sound calm, controlled and confident.
These qualities go much deeper than communication skills. They reflect a particular psychological state — one that allows people to think clearly, manage pressure and make better decisions.
1. Calm
Calm people are comfortable with themselves.
They don't need to constantly prove their importance, compete for attention or respond immediately to everything around them.
They can sit with uncertainty.
They can listen.
They can pause before reacting.
This gives them an important psychological advantage: they create space between what happens and how they respond.
Instead of being controlled by their emotions, they have greater control over them.
Moreover, others feel comfortable, less anxious and more secure around someone who is calm.
2. Controlled
Control is not about suppressing your emotions.
It is about managing them rather than being managed by them.
High achievers experience frustration, pressure, fear and uncertainty just like everyone else. The difference is often in how they respond.
They don't necessarily act on their first emotional impulse.
They think before they speak.
They choose their priorities.
They can stay focused when things become difficult.
This self-regulation creates consistency. Consistency is one of the foundations of achievement.
The same psychological control becomes visible in communication.
They don't rush when challenged. They don't become unnecessarily defensive. They don't allow nervousness to dictate their voice or behaviour.
3. Confident
Confidence begins internally.
A genuinely confident person doesn't need constant external validation.
They are comfortable not being perfect.
Their confidence comes from self-trust.
Their inner confidence is visible in their posture, facial expressions, and speech.
